Chapter 1-Current Energy Usage


The purpose of the Poultry House Evaluation Service was to provide growers with options for reducing energy usage in their poultry houses. In order to evaluate the magnitude of any reduction it is important to know the current energy usage. There was a wide range of past energy usage by the different farms sampled. It should be noted that the level of energy use by a farm does not appear to be correlated with the level of production efficiency on that farm. The economic impacts of any recommended modifications, therefore, will vary from farm to farm and be farm-specific.

The level of propane and electricity used by each of the 14 farms evaluated are shown in Figure 1.1 and Figure 1.2, respectively. The usage was converted to a weight basis (i.e., per 1,000 lbs of broilers sold) to allow for comparisons between farms. The same identification number was used for the farms in Figures 1.1 and 1.2.
